Abstract

The importance of accountability in state financial management is the main focus in the implementation of public organizations, because it can determine the continuity and gain the trust of the public. This study aims to analyze the accountability of village fund management in Kalinusu Village, Bumiayu District, Brebes Regency in 2021. Descriptive qualitative method was used to describe the accountability of village fund management. The research was conducted in Kalinusu Village, Bumiayu Subdistrict, Brebes Regency. The selection of informants was carried out using purposive sampling technique, with 15 informants selected from various elements considered to have knowledge about the management and reporting of the Village Fund. This research focused on one research focus, namely the accountability of Village Fund management in Kalinusu Village. Data were collected using observation, interviews, and documentation. The collected data were analyzed using descriptive qualitative research methods with interactive techniques. To ensure the validity of the research data, data triangulation techniques were used. The results showed that the Kalinusu Village Government has successfully applied the principles of accountability, namely transparency, accountability, control, responsibility, and responsiveness in the management of the Village Fund. Overall, the Kalinusu Village government has demonstrated high responsibility in managing the Village Fund, has met competency standards, complied with regulations, and acted transparently and accountably. Thus, community trust in the village government increases, and the gap between the community and the government can be bridged.

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of transformational leadership, work motivation, and job satisfaction on employees performance in PDAM Brebes Regency office. The method used in this study is survey method that involved 116 respondents. The data gained were analyzed using validity test, reliability test, path analysis, and hypothesis testing. The results of this study and calculation data from Path Analysis show that transformational leadership, work motivation, job satisfaction affect employees’ performance.

Abstract

This study aims to examine the influence of transformational leadership, coaching leadership, and digital leadership on teachers' digital competence in Pemalang Regency. The research uses a quantitative approach with a correlational survey method. Data were collected through questionnaires from a sample of 205 teachers and analyzed using multiple linear regression. The results showed that transformational leadership, coaching leadership, and digital leadership have a significant and positive influence on digital competence. This implies that school leadership plays a key role in enhancing teachers' digital skills.
